Security tightened after armed intrusion at Pattani biomass plant
An unknown number of armed intruders stormed a biomass power plant in Pattani's Nong Chik district early this morning, rounding up security personnel before an explosion was heard within the facility.
A ranger task force was alerted to the intrusion at around 12.40am this morning by the Pattani Green Biomass Power Plant in Lipasango sub-district.
The intruders entered the facility through its rear section before threatening plant personnel with firearms and forcing them and security guards to gather at the front entrance.
An explosion was subsequently heard within the plant compound.
The task force deployed forces to secure the area, setting up checkpoints and roadblocks around the site.
Officials are currently inspecting the scene, assessing the damage, collecting forensic evidence and pursuing those responsible for the incident.
No injuries or fatalities had been reported at press time.
Security measures have since been strengthened in the area to reassure residents and businesses and the public has been urged to follow information released through official channels and refrain from sharing unverified reports that could cause confusion or hinder ongoing operations.
